Set the Google Forms trigger as “Form response submitted”

A playbook always starts with a trigger, which is responsible for detecting changes in your connected applications and responding accordingly.

Add the Google Forms trigger to initiate your playbook's actions every time a form response is submitted. Click "Add trigger" in your playbook and choose "Form response submitted" from the dropdown menu under Google Forms.

If you still need to connect your Google Forms account to Relay.app yet, a prompt will guide you through the process.

2

Add the “Update or create contact” step in Google Contacts

Integrate the Google Contacts automation into your playbook to ensure the prompt creation or updating of a contact in Google Contacts every time a form response is submitted in Google Forms.

Click the "Add step" button, locate the “Update or create contact” automation for Google Contacts, and input the mandatory and relevant details.

If your Google Contacts account still needs to be connected to Relay.app, you will be prompted to complete that connection. Make sure to allow the necessary permissions for Relay.app to sync with your Google Contacts account.

3

Activate your playbook

Activating your playbook is the last step in the process. Once you turn it on, it will automatically create or update a contact in Google Contacts every time a form response is submitted in Google Forms without requiring manual intervention.

To activate your playbook, click the toggle button at the header. Before activating, we recommend performing a test run of your playbook to ensure all the steps work seamlessly together.
